The given name Alex can be either masculine or feminine and is the short form of Alexandria or Alexander or other names that start with Alex. The masculine name Alexander is the Latinized version of the Greek name Alexandros that means "defending men". Short form of Alexandra and Alexis; also commonly used as an independent given name. From the Greek name (Alexandros), which meant "defending men" from Greek (alexo) "to defend, help" and (aner) "man".
Alexander the Great, King of Macedon, is the most famous bearer of this name. In the 4th century BC he built a huge empire out of Greece, Egypt, Persia, and parts of India.
